MAYSVILLE — Bobby Jean Berry Campbell, 61, of Maysville, Kentucky, passed away peacefully on September 15, 2025, just days before her 62nd birthday.
Born on September 20, 1963, Bobby was the daughter of the late Lenora Bush Berry and James E. Berry Sr.
She was also preceded in death by her beloved twin children, Lauren Campbell and Brandon Campbell. Bobby will be deeply missed by her children, Sierrah B. Meade and Alexander S. Campbell; her grandson, Campbell Meade; her siblings, JoAnn (Frank) Burns, Jacqueline (Fred) Bundick, Sharon Burns, James (Penney) Berry, and Lisa Simpson; her aunt, Helen Haley; her nieces, Michelle Bundick, Kierra Gibbs, and Annelise Reetz; her nephews, Adam (Felisha) Burns, Jonathon (Linda) Bundick, and Larry Burns; her great-nephew, Izaia Burns; her forever brother-in-law, Larry Burns Sr, and her special cousin, Linda Frey Thomas.
Bobby found joy in life's simple pleasures. She loved working on puzzles, collecting Thomas Kinkade pieces, admiring lighthouses, exploring new foods, and playing her favorite games.
She was known for being "quite the character," bringing laughter wherever she went.
A celebration of Bobby's life will be held on Sept. 21, 2025, located at Washington Missionary Baptist Church, 504 Clark Street, Maysville, KY 41056, at 2 p.m.
Her memory will forever remain in the hearts of those who knew and loved her.
